Problems solved by technology

[0004] However, the VPN 10 requires each of the LANs 26 and 30 to be connected to the Internet 12 via a fixed Internet address, and the cost of applying a fixed Internet address is higher than that of a dynamic Internet address. In addition, the settings of LAN 26 and LAN 30 cannot be easily moved without changing the service of the fixed Internet address

[0024] Please refer to figure 2 , figure 2 It is a schematic diagram of a roaming LAN 50 according to the first embodiment of the present invention. Unlike the known VPN 10 , a network device only needs an Internet connection 60 to provide a dynamic Internet address to join the roaming LAN 50 . Therefore, there is no fixed Internet address limitation, so network devices can quickly and easily join the roaming LAN 50 anywhere, and all network devices can communicate with network devices in other regions via the Internet 52 .

[0025] Each network device is connected to the roaming LAN 50 via an Internet connection 60, such as a connection provided by xDSL or a connection provided by other broadband Internet networks. A broadband sharing device 62 includes a switch or a hub for enabling network devices connected to the broadband sharing device 62 to share the Internet connection 60 . Abstract

The invention provides a roaming local area network. The roaming LAN includes a first broadband sharing device for sharing a first dynamic Internet address, a first network device group connected to the first broadband sharing device, and a second broadband sharing device for sharing a The second floating Internet address and a second network device group are connected to the second broadband sharing device, wherein the first network device in the first and second network device groups has a unique virtual Internet address. In addition, a host is connected to an Internet through a fixed Internet address, and the host can control data transmission between the first and second network device groups.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a local area network, in particular to a roaming local area network established in the Internet by using a dynamic Internet address. Background technique [0002] Due to the popularization of computers and network equipment, local area network (LAN) also grows greatly. A local area network can be easily established in a small area, such as a home or office, etc., and all computers can access other computers or network devices in the local area network, and use a firewall (firewall) to provide external high privacy and high security. On the other hand, when a private network is required between two separate networks, a virtual private network (virtual private network, VPN) will be used, and the virtual private network utilizes the encryption technology of the Internet Protocol (Internet Protocol, IP) and A virtual channel is established through the Internet to form a structure similar to a private network.
